[GridPlus] Bumps eth-lattice-keyring to v0.12.3 #15981

  • Updates @ethereumjs/util to v8.0.0 to reduce bundle size
  • Removes secp256k1 and @ethereumjs/common to reduce bundle size
  • Updates gridplus-sdk to v2.2.9
    • Adds caching for calls to block explorers to improve UX (PR)
